This title is proving to be everything I needed-and then some! What impresses me most is the consistency of the contents. I have discovered zero errors in the book. There is much hands-on, and plenty of 'little extras' that contribute to the reader's knowledge. Illustrations are plentiful. The text covers topics ranging from starting the program, to macros. If there ever was a book that 'takes the reader by the hand' and yet allows the reader to maintain his dignity, this is it! I will definitely look for these authors before making a similar purchase.

Provides a very good hands-on approach to using MSAccess. The text introduces a concept which is then immediately reinforced with either a pictorial example or an on-computer exercise (or both!). Not as cute as some of the other books written to provide "off line" documentation. I own a lot of do-it-yourself computer books and I was very pleased with this one (and its companion on Excel)
